Transaction afa8e2abcf12acddb9959e76b71e8c10142ad71e2ec725845307727e219e67bd

1 Input
2 Outputs
  • afa8e2abcf12acddb9959e76b71e8c10142ad71e2ec725845307727e219e67bd:0
  • value  697500
    address  38kLP6odVd86gfB9AD9Zg2CCd6BTAeeU5n
  • afa8e2abcf12acddb9959e76b71e8c10142ad71e2ec725845307727e219e67bd:1
  • value  1628706
    address  1FnMTMPDRTm8m3JP6ffapHvVoXvxdPexqY